Diagnostic assessment

In order to determine ADHD in adults, a detailed psychiatric assessment must be performed. The primary test is a diagnostic interview. It is a comprehensive questionnaire that will determine how do you get assessed for adhd the patient's symptoms impact the way they live their lives.

A person with ADHD might have trouble controlling their anger. They may also have difficulties keeping their schedules in order. Some people suffer from mild symptoms, whereas others suffer from more severe symptoms.

These symptoms can be addressed by a variety of methods. A person with the disorder needs to be assessed for adhd for signs of depression and anxiety. These symptoms can result in hopelessness, changes of sleeping and eating habits, and difficulties with daily activities.

Typical adult ADHD tests are conducted by a physician or healthcare professional. The tests are conducted by asking questions about the patient's present and past health, as well as their family history. The process can last up three hours.

The medical practitioner may also take tests or conduct behavior surveys in addition to the diagnostic interview. These tests can be used to assess cognitive function, emotional disorders or social behaviors. However, it is crucial to have tests interpreted by an experienced medical professional.

These tests and questionnaires can be used to track the progress of the patient during treatment. Adults with the disorder tend to exhibit an impulsive and inattention. A test can provide relief and make it easier for a patient to seek the help that he/she needs.

The symptoms of depression include feeling hopeless and a lack of interest in your daily routine. Anxiety symptoms may include muscle tension, restlessness , and panic attacks. Patients could also be suffering from insomnia or substance abuse.

The physician will usually ask for information from the patient's parents, siblings, and close family members. The doctor may also request that the patient's partner be interviewed.

Academic outcomes

The effect of ADHD on the academic outcomes is extensively studied in North America. In addition an increasing amount of research has demonstrated the positive impact of ADHD treatment on academic performance.

Research has revealed that ADHD can have long-term consequences. It can affect children's academic performance. Moreover the untreated ADHD is a risk factor for poor long-term health and social health.

A study of young adults suffering from ADHD was done to determine whether their academic performance was lower than that of peers without the disorder. However, the link between ADHD symptoms and academic performance was not as strong.

Another study explored the effects of ADHD treatment on academic performance, using a cross-sectional design. Researchers used data from 400 college students in North Carolina, Pennsylvania, and Rhode Island. Their findings revealed that treatment was linked to significant improvements in long-term academic performance.

A second study showed that self-reported GPAs were subject to response biases. They also discovered that ADHD symptoms with more severe severity were associated with lower grades.

Psychoeducational programs focused on improving academic performance included behavioral interventions like coaching and testing accommodations. These findings could help students in universities who have been diagnosed with ADHD. However, the long-term effects of ADHD on academic outcomes are still not fully understood.
